What are the responsibilities and job description for the Staff Full-Stack Engineer position at Terial?
About Terial:
Terial is disrupting the ~$13 trillion global construction industry with modern, AI-powered
operating software for commercial roofers and contractors. The industry has traditionally been underserved by technology, creating a perfect storm for rapid growth and market adoption.
Our platform unifies project management, service management, CRM, scheduling, reporting, and job costing into a single intuitive solution. We’re a small, focused team with a high bar for quality, shipping weekly with an emphasis on collaboration, strong engineering culture, and deep customer insight.
Role Overview:
We’re looking for a Staff Full-Stack Engineer with 10 years of experience and strong back-end skills. You will help shape the product, lead technical decisions, and own end-to-end execution in a focused, ownership-driven environment.
Key Responsibilities:
- Full-stack development: build full-stack, user-facing features rapidly with high quality
- Backend development: be responsible for our app’s backend infrastructure and architecture. Drive the technical vision, strategy, and roadmap, ensuring our backend is scalable and highly reliable
- Cross-Functional Collaboration: work closely with team to scope, implement, and refine features, shipping high quality code on a weekly basis
- Champion Quality & Stability: mentor junior developers, review their pull requests, and champion extremely clean, well organized code
Qualifications:
- 10 years of experience as a software engineer
- 5 years of TypeScript experience
- Full-stack developer who leans towards the backend
- Professional experience working with at least 5 of the following: Amazon AWS, building 3rd party integrations, search indexes, database replicas, caches, queues, cron jobs, API gateways, monitoring/analytics/logging, infrastructure as code, AI/ML
- Must be highly self motivated and value doing high quality work at velocity in a highly collaborative environment
- We are in person in NYC with remote Fridays and a few remote weeks per year
Compensation:
Salary: $150-180k per annum, commensurate with experience.
Generous equity compensation, giving you a stake in our shared success.
Benefits
- Comprehensive medical, vision and dental insurance plans offered (with up to 100% covered)
- 401K plan
- Unlimited PTO
- Weekly team lunch at NYC office
Why Join Us?
At Terial, you'll have the opportunity to shape the future of the built world while working at the intersection of construction, real estate, and fintech. Beyond the chance to build and scale a transformative product, you’ll join a passionate, driven team that values collaboration, innovation, and meaningful impact.
If you're ready to make an impact in a rapidly evolving industry as a Staff Full-Stack Engineer, we want to hear from you!
Salary : $150,000 - $180,000